What You’ll Need
Gather the following ingredients to whip up this delightful dessert.
For the Cake
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 ½ cups granulated s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up buttermilk
- 3 large eggs
- 1 tbsp lemon zest, freshly grated
- 1 tbsp lemon juice, fresh
- 2 t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 ½ cups blueberries, fresh or frozen
For the Cream Cheese Icing
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 4 cups powdered sugar
- ¼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 2 tbsp lemon juice, fresh
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
Frozen blueberries work well in this recipe.
Substitutions & Swaps
- Buttermilk: Use milk with vinegar.
- Lemon juice: Lime juice for a twist.
- Cream cheese: Mascarpone for a different flavor.
- Fresh blueberries: Choose raspberries instead.
How to Make It
Start your baking adventure with these simple steps.
Preheat the o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a bundt pan with cooking spray or butter.
Mix the batter
In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y.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ition. Stir in the lemon zest and lemon juice.
Combine dry ingredients
In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add this mixture to the creamed mixture, alternating with buttermilk, starting and ending with flour. Gently fold in the blueberries.
Bake the cake
Pour the batter into the prepared bundt pan, smoothing the top. Bake for 55-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Allow it to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
Prepare the icing
While the cake cools, beat together the softened cream cheese and butter until creamy. Gradually add the powdered sugar, mixing until smooth. Stir in the lemon juice and vanilla extract.
Ice the cake
Once the cake is completely cool, drizzle the cream cheese icing over the top. Let it set for a few minutes before slicing.
How to Store It
Fridge: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
Freezer: Yes, wrap well for up to 3 months.
Reheat: Microwave slices for 10-15 seconds.
Tips for Best Results
- Use room temperature ingredients for a smoother batter.
- Don’t overmix the batter to keep the cake tender.
- Let the cake cool completely before icing to prevent melting.
- Use fresh lemon juice for a brighter flavor.
